The information density is high for a product-led site. While H3 headings like EXPERIENCE THE PURE ESSENCE OF RIDING are pure marketing fluff, the body text delivers significant technical substance. Each model page contains a detailed SCHEDA TECNICA with specific metrics including displacement (450 cc), power (35 kW), torque (39.1 Nm), and weight (175 kg). The ratio of fluff to specific technical nouns is favorable compared to typical automotive marketing.

There is zero detectable semantic drift between the primary signal and sub-page delivery. The homepage H1 Un nuovo modo di vivere la strada sets a lifestyle expectation that is immediately supported by specific product categories like PIEGA 452 and MUD 452. Unlike many automotive sites, the pricing is transparently listed on sub-pages (e.g., 6.390 euro), maintaining consistency between the premium ‘brand’ feel and the ‘sales’ reality.

Trust theatre is minimal but present. The review_count is stagnant at 2 across multiple pages, and while there is 1 proof_link, it lacks a robust path to third-party verification like Google Reviews or Trustpilot. The claim of A WINNING STORY. SINCE 1948 is a strong authority signal that remains largely unsubstantiated by external evidence or a historical archive within the analyzed pages.

Proof density is respectable due to the granular technical data and specific pricing inclusive of VAT. The site provides 8+ technical specifications per model, which qualifies as high specificity. The main deficit is the absence of external validation paths (press reviews or user-generated content) to verify the ’emotional’ claims made in the H2 and H5 headings.

The site uses several industry clichés such as FEEL THE TRUE SPIRIT OF THE ROAD and YOUR BIKE YOUR STYLE. However, it avoids the most egregious dealership BS by naming a specific celebrity designer, Rodolfo Frascoli, which provides a unique value proposition that cannot be easily copy-pasted. The use of template language like Scopri i rivenditori is standard for the industry but functional rather than deceptive.

There are minor authority gaps in the structured data. The schema_json is a generic WebPage/WebSite graph rather than a specific Brand or MotorcycleDealer schema, which would allow for sameAs links to verify its 1948 heritage. Mentioning designer Rodolfo Frascoli by name provides authority, but the lack of Person schema or links to his portfolio represents a missed opportunity for technical validation of that claim.

The performance claims are largely backed by the technical specification sheets provided. For example, the claim of ‘elevate prestazioni di guida’ is coupled with the mention of ‘pompa e pinza anteriore Brembo radiali,’ providing a concrete hardware justification for the marketing claim. The marketing tone remains high-energy, but it anchors itself in verifiable mechanical components.
